A man convicted in the murder of a Lincoln police officer 34 years ago says he does not want to be paroled.

"I do not want out of prison," James Lorin Porter, Sr., wrote in a letter he sent to Placer County officials, Lincoln police, prison officials and newspapers.

Others agree.

"Our position is that Mr. Porter should not be granted parole," said Placer County Deputy District Attorney Cliff Gessner. "He still poses a danger to society."
